Model Features for Process Manufacturing

Select from the following features when creating a model for a process manufacturing plant.

Category/Subcategory Feature Level Numeric/Categorical Description
Management/Operation Operation Planned Duration For each routing operation. Numeric Difference between planned completion date and planned start date of the step.
Management/Operation Operation Actual Duration For each routing operation. Numeric Difference between actual completion date and actual start date of the step. If the operation actual duration is not available while running the predictions for the batch, the operation planned duration is considered.
Management/Operation Operation Duration Variance For each routing operation. Numeric Difference between the planned step duration and the actual step duration.
Management/Operation Operation Duration Variance % For each routing operation. Numeric Ratio of the difference between the planned and actual duration to the planned duration of the step.

Tip: Best feature for analyzing the duration of non-uniform batch sizes.

Management/Operation Operation Planned Offset For each routing operation. Numeric Offset between the previous step's planned completion and the current step's planned start date.
Management/Operation Operation Actual Offset For each routing operation. Numeric Offset between the previous step's actual completion and the current step's actual start date.
Management/Operation Operation Offset Variance For each routing operation. Numeric Difference between the planned offset and the actual offset.
Management/Operation Unplanned Operation Planned Offset For each unplanned operation. Numeric Offset between the previous step's planned completion and the current (unplanned) step's planned start date.
Management/Operation Unplanned Operation Actual Offset For each unplanned operation. Numeric Offset between the previous step's actual completion and the current (unplanned) step's actual start date.
Management/Operation Unplanned Operation Offset Variance For each unplanned operation. Numeric Difference between the planned offset and the actual offset of the unplanned operation.
Management/Activity Activity Plan Duration For each routing operation activity. Numeric Difference between the planned completion date and the planned start date of the activity.
Management/Activity Activity Actual Duration For each routing operation activity. Numeric Difference between the actual completion date and the actual start date of the activity.
Management/Activity Activity Duration Variance For each routing operation activity. Numeric Difference between the planned activity duration and the actual activity duration.
Management/Activity Activity Duration Variance % For each routing operation activity. Numeric Ratio of Difference between planned and actual duration to the planned duration of the activity.
Method/Operation Unplanned Operation Exist For each unplanned operation. Boolean Determines whether any unplanned operation was added (a step not included in the routing definition).
Method/Operation Unplanned Operation Actual Duration For each unplanned operation. Numeric Difference between actual completion date and actual start date of the unplanned operation.
Method/Activity Unplanned Activity Exist For each unplanned activity. Boolean Determines whether any unplanned activity was added (activity not included in the routing definition).
Method/Activity Unplanned Activity Actual Duration For each unplanned activity added to an existing operation. Numeric Difference between actual completion date and actual start date of the unplanned activity added to an existing operation.
Method/Exception Material Exceptions Exist For each routing operation. Boolean (Y/N) Determines whether there are any material exceptions created for the operation.
Method/Exception Processing Exceptions Exist For each routing operation. Boolean (Y/N) Determines whether there are any processing exceptions created for the operation.
Method/Exception Resource Exceptions Exist For each routing operation. Boolean (Y/N) Determines whether there are any resource exceptions created for the operation.
Method/Exception Other Exceptions Exist For each routing operation. Boolean (Y/N) Determines whether there are any other exceptions created for the operation.
Machine/Activity Activity Primary Equipment For each routing operation activity. Categorical Primary equipment of the activity.
Machine/Activity Unplanned Equipment Exist For each unplanned activity. Boolean Determines whether any unplanned equipment is in use (equipment not included in the routing definition).
Machine/Equipment Equipment Actual Usage For each routing operation activity equipment. Numeric Actual usage of the equipment.
Machine/Equipment Unplanned Equipment Actual Usage For each unplanned equipment instance of the existing operation/activity. Numeric Actual usage of the unplanned equipment.
Machine/Equipment Unplanned Equipment Actual Quantity For each unplanned equipment instance. Numeric Actual processing quantity for the unplanned equipment.
Machine/Equipment Equipment Usage Variance For each routing operation activity equipment. Numeric Difference between planned and actual usage of the equipment.
Machine/Equipment Equipment Usage Variance % For each routing operation activity equipment. Numeric The ratio of the difference between planned and actual equipment usage to the planned usage of the equipment.

Tip: Best feature for analyzing the usage variations between non-uniform batch sizes.

Machine/Equipment Equipment Actual Quantity For each routing operation activity equipment. Numeric Actual quantity processed by the equipment.
Machine/Equipment Equipment Quantity Variance For each routing operation activity equipment. Numeric Difference between planned and actual quantity processed by the equipment.
Machine/Equipment Equipment Quantity Variance % For each routing operation activity equipment. Numeric The ratio of the difference between planned and actual equipment quantity to the planned quantity of the equipment.

Tip: Best predictor for analyzing the quantity variations between non-uniform batch sizes.

Machine/Equipment Equipment Instance Used For each routing operation activity equipment instance. Boolean (Y/N) Determines whether the equipment instance is used or not.
Machine/Process Parameter Parameter Value For each routing operation activity equipment process parameter. Numeric Process parameter value of the equipment parameter.
Machine/Process Parameter Parameter Value Deviation For each routing operation activity equipment process parameter. Numeric Difference between the target and actual value of the process parameter.
Machine/Process Parameter Parameter Value Outside Range For each routing operation activity equipment process parameter. Boolean Determines whether the parameter actual value is outside the range specified in the routing process parameter definition.
Machine/Sensor Summary <<Name of the Sensor Summary>>
For example, the Average Context has Time Segment: Full, Parameter: Temperature, Equipment: Furnace, Activity: RUNTIME, Operation: MELT.
For each routing operation activity equipment with sensor parameters mapped in the device mapping and associated to the production analysis feature set. Numeric The computed summary function value.
For example, the average temperature of the full range of the Furnace temperature in the Runtime activity of the Melt operation.
Material/Quantity Ingredient Actual Quantity For each operation material line item. Numeric Actual quantity of the ingredient issued to the operation.
Material/Quantity Ingredient Quantity Variance For each operation material line item. Numeric Difference between planned and actual quantity of the ingredient issued to the operation.
Material/Quantity Ingredient Quantity Variance % For each operation ingredient. Numeric Ratio of the difference between the planned and actual quantity to the planned quantity of the ingredient issued to the operation.

Tip: Best predictor for analyzing the material quantity variations between non-uniform batch sizes.

Material/Byproduct Byproduct Quantity Variance For each operation byproduct. Numeric Difference between the planned and actual quantity of the byproduct yielded to the operation.
Material/Byproduct Byproduct Quantity Variance % For each operation byproduct. Numeric Ratio of the difference between the planned and actual quantity to the planned quantity of the byproduct yielded to the operation.

Tip: Best predictor for analyzing the byproduct quantity variations between non-uniform batch sizes.

Material/Lot Grade Lot Grade Quantity For each operation ingredient lot grade. Numeric Quantity of the ingredient lot of a specific grade issued to the operation.
Material/Quality Test Ingredient Quality Result (Weighted Average) For each operation ingredient supplier specification test. Numeric Weighted average of the test results of all the ingredient samples over each lot quantity issued.
Material/Quality Test WIP Quality Result (Latest) For each operation ingredient supplier specification test. Numeric Latest WIP quality sample test result.
Material/Ingredient Unplanned Ingredient Exists For each unplanned ingredient. Boolean Determines whether an unplanned ingredient was added (an ingredient not included in the recipe definition).
Material/Ingredient Unplanned Ingredient Actual Quantity For each unplanned ingredient. Boolean Actual quantity of the unplanned ingredient issued to the operation.

Model Features for Discrete Manufacturing

Select from the following features when creating a model for a discrete manufacturing plant.

Category/Subcategory Feature Level Numeric/Categorical Description
Management/Operation Operation Actual Duration For each routing operation. Numeric The actual duration for each operation that is part of an item's standard routing. This feature is not available for serial analysis.
Management/Operation Operation Duration Variance % For each routing operation. Numeric Ratio of the difference between the planned and actual duration to the planned duration for each operation included in the item's standard routing. This feature is not available for serial analysis.
Management/Operation Deviation Unplanned Operations Exist For each additional operation at work order level. Categorical Indicates whether the operation is an additional operation added during WIP and not part of an item's standard routing.
Management/Operation Deviation Unplanned Operations Exist At work order level. Categorical Indicates whether the operation is an additional operation added during WIP and not part of an item's standard routing. This feature is not available for serial analysis.
Management/Operation Deviation Unplanned Operation Actual Duration For each additional operation at work order level. Numeric The actual duration of an additional operation added during WIP and not part of an item's standard routing. This feature is not available for serial analysis.
Manpower/Operator Operator Alternatives Used For each routing operation. Categorical Indicates whether the operator resources used are primary resources, alternate resources defined in the operation as part of a standard routing, or unplanned resources used in the operation. The values can be all primary, all alternate, all unplanned, or combinations of primary, alternate, and unplanned.
Manpower/Operator Operator Actual Usage For each routing operation primary resource. Numeric The actual usage of an operator defined as a primary resource for an operation in the standard routing.
Manpower/Operator Operator Usage Variance % For each routing operation primary resource. Numeric The ratio of the difference between planned and actual operator usage to the planned usage of the operator. The operator is defined as a primary resource for an operation in the standard routing.
Manpower/Operator Operator Instance Worked For each routing operation primary resource. Categorical Indicates the actual operator instance defined as a primary resource or alternate resource for an operation in the standard routing.
Manpower/Operator Operation Deviation Operator Alternatives Used (Unplanned Operation) For each additional operation at work order level. Categorical Indicates whether operator resources used are primary resources, alternate resources defined in the operation as part of the standard routing, or unplanned resources used in the operation.
This feature displays values only if additional operations are added in WIP and are not part of the standard routing.
Manpower/Operator Operation Deviation Operator Actual Usage (Unplanned Operation) For each additional operation actual resource. Numeric The actual usage of an operator in the operation when the operation is added as an additional operation during WIP and is not part of the standard routing.
Manpower/Operator Deviation Unplanned Operator Actual Usage For each routing operation additional resource. Numeric The actual usage of an operator in the additional operations added during WIP and not included in the standard routing.
Manpower/Operator Alternate Alternate Operator Actual Usage For each routing operation alternate resource. Numeric The actual usage of an operator defined as an alternate resource for an operation in the standard routing.
Manpower/Operator Alternate Alternate Operator Usage Variance % For each routing operation alternate resource. Numeric The ratio of the difference between planned and actual alternate operator usage to the planned usage of the alternate operator. The operator is defined as an alternate resource for an operation in the standard routing.
Machine/Equipment Equipment Alternatives Used For each routing operation. Categorical Indicates whether the equipment resources used are primary resources, alternate resources defined in the operation as part of standard routing, or unplanned resources used in the operation. The values can be all primary, all alternate, all unplanned, or combinations of primary, alternate, and unplanned.
Machine/Equipment Equipment Actual Usage For each routing operation primary resource. Numeric The actual usage of equipment in the operation defined as a primary resource in the standard routing.
Machine/Equipment Equipment Usage Variance % For each routing operation primary resource. Numeric The ratio of the difference between planned and actual equipment usage to the planned usage of the equipment. The equipment is defined as a primary resource for an operation in the standard routing.
Machine/Equipment Equipment Instance Used For each routing operation primary resource. Categorical Indicates the actual equipment instance defined as the primary resource or alternate resource for an operation in the standard routing.
Machine/Equipment Operation Deviation Equipment Alternatives Used (Unplanned Operation) For each additional operation at work order level. Categorical Indicates whether operator resources used are primary resources, alternate resources defined in the operation as part of the standard routing, or unplanned resources used in the operation. The values can be all primary, all alternate, all unplanned, or combinations of primary, alternate, and unplanned.
This feature displays values only if additional operations are added in WIP and are not part of the standard routing.
Machine/Equipment Operation Deviation Equipment Actual Usage (Unplanned Operation) For each additional operation actual resource. Numeric The actual usage of equipment in the operation when the operation is added as an additional operation during WIP and is not part of the standard routing.
Machine/Equipment Deviation Unplanned Equipment Actual Usage For each routing operation additional resource. Numeric The actual usage of equipment in the additional operations added during WIP and not included in the standard routing.
Machine/Equipment Alternate Alternate Equipment Actual Usage For each routing operation alternate resource. Numeric The actual usage of equipment defined as an alternate resource for an operation in the standard routing.
Machine/Equipment Alternate Alternate Equipment Usage Variance % For each routing operation alternate resource. Numeric The ratio of the difference between planned and actual alternate equipment usage to the planned usage of the alternate equipment. The equipment is defined as an alternate resource for an operation in the standard routing.
Machine/Sensor Summary <<Name of the Sensor Summary>>
For example, Maximum Context includes Time Segment: Segment (0-30 mins), Parameter: Vibration, Equipment: Robot, Operation: Assembly.
For each routing operation equipment with sensor parameters mapped in the device mapping and associated to the production analysis feature set. Numeric Feature extracted from time series data by dividing the time series data into segments and applying functions based on the time series feature set's definition. For example, the maximum vibration of the robot equipment in the assembly operation during the (0-30 mins) segment.
Method/Exception Operation Exceptions Exist (Unplanned Operation) For each additional operation at work order level. Categorical Indicates whether there are any exceptions in the additional operations added in WIP which are not part of the standard routing.
Acceptable values are Yes or No.
Method/Operation Exception Exist Operation Exceptions Exist For each routing operation. Categorical Indicates whether there are any exceptions in the operations that are part of the standard routing. Acceptable values are Yes or No.
Material/Quantity Component Alternatives Used For each routing operation. Categorical Indicates whether the components used are primary components, substitute components defined in standard bills of material, or unplanned components. Acceptable values are all primary, all substitute, all unplanned, and combinations of primary, substitute, and unplanned.
Material/Quantity Component Actual Quantity For each component. Numeric The actual quantity of a primary component issued to a WIP job. This feature is limited to Push type components only.
Material/Quantity Component Quantity Variance % For each component. Numeric The variance percentage of a primary component quantity issued to a WIP job. This feature is limited to Push type components only.
Material/Quantity Highest Variance Component For each routing operation. Categorical Provides the name of the component with the maximum usage quantity deviation in a WIP job. This feature is limited to Push type components only.
Material/Lot Number Count of Lots Consumed For each routing operation lot controlled component. Numeric Provides the count of component lots that are issued to the WIP job.
Material/Supplier Supplier of Lot For each routing operation lot controlled buy component. Categorical Provides the name of the supplier that provides the maximum number of components issued in a lot for the WIP job.
Material/Supplier Multiple Suppliers for Lot For each routing operation lot controlled buy component. Categorical Indicates if there are multiple suppliers who supplied the component lots that are issued to a WIP job. Acceptable values are Yes or No.
Material/Substitute Component Substitute Component Actual Quantity For each substitute component at routing level. Numeric The actual quantity of substitute component issued to a WIP job. This feature is limited to Push type components only.
Material/Substitute Component Substitute Component Quantity Variance % For each substitute component. Numeric The variance percentage of a substitute component quantity issued to a WIP job. This feature is limited to Push type components only.
Material/Component Deviation Unplanned Component Actual Quantity For each additional component. Numeric The actual quantity of an unplanned component that is issued to a WIP job. Unplanned components are not a part of standard bills of material. This feature is limited to Push type components only.
Material/Component Operation Deviation Component Actual Quantity (Unplanned Operation) For each additional operation component. Numeric The actual quantity of a primary component issued to a WIP job for an additional operation added in WIP and not part of the standard routing. This feature is limited to Push type components only.
Material/Quality Test WIP Quality Result (Latest) For each operation component supplier specification test. Numeric WIP quality sample test result average.
Material/Quality Test Component Quality Result (Weighted Average) For each operation component supplier specification test. Numeric The weighted average of test results for component samples of each lot quantity issued.
Output Operation First Pass Yield For each operation. Numeric The percentage of good quantity completed compared to the total quantity completed in the work order operation.
Output Work Order First Pass Yield For each work order. Numeric The percentage of good quantity completed compared to the total quantity of the work order.
